From School Library Journal

Gr 3 Up—Yousafzai, the youngest recipient of the Nobel Peace Prize and campaigner for the rights of all children to attend school, has written her first picture book. It is an autobiographical account of her life designed for younger readers. She gently introduces her childhood in Pakistan and recounts a favorite TV show where a young boy has a magic pencil that he uses to help people. The magic pencil becomes a reoccurring motif throughout the work on how to make the world a better place. Of the infamous Taliban violence, she simply says, "My voice became so powerful that the dangerous men tried to silence me. But they failed." The beautifully written book goes on to describe Yousafzai's quest for justice and the importance of finding one's voice. The enchanting story is accompanied by the beautiful illustrations of duo Sebastien Cosset and Maries Pommepuy, also known as "Kerascoët." Sparse pen and ink outlines the bright, soft watercolors that effortlessly depict Yousafzai's daily life and then are enhanced by delicate gold overlay drawings that highlight her magical wishes for a better world and the power that a single voice can command. This is a wonderful read for younger students that will also provide insight and encourage discussion about the wider world. Included are biographical notes and photos of Yousafzai and her family. VERDICT The simplicity of Yousafzai's writing and the powerful message she sends, make this book inspirational for all. Highly recommended.—Carole Phillips, Greenacres Elementary School, Scarsdale, NY

This is a beautiful little book with so many threads to follow. First, there is the thread of the "magic pen." The narrator (Malala) wishes for a magic pen, and as she learns more about her world, what she says she will do with that magic pen subtly changes from drawing a lock on her bedroom door to keep out her brothers to drawing a world without conflict where boys and girls are equal. There is a soft touch in the book that will draw in very young readers who recognize right away when they are being preached at versus when they are reading a story. This is a story. The other threads are educating girls, of course, and realizing the poverty within her community, and fighting the violence of the Taliban with words. If you are like me, you wondered how a book intended for very young audiences would deal with the terrifying act of violence done to Malala. The page where this occurs is simple, black, and says only that "My voice became so powerful that the dangersou men tried to silence me. But they failed." If you look closely, she is wearing a hospital bracelet and looking out the window, but I think most adult readers could read this page and continue without a child asking what happened to her. The older the child, the more likely the question. The last two pages are anecdotal summaries, and those do state that Malala was attacked, again not specifying what that means. Those who know and want to fill in the details have a beautiful framework in which to do so; those who prefer to focus on Malala as a leader for justice, peace, and education will find this to be a inspiring text. The illustrations have glittering gold throughout the first half of the narrative where the focus is on the magic pen. Then the book shifts focus from imagining to doing. I *LOVE* the inherent theme that imagining is the precursor to action and change. In the second half of the book are crumbling buildings, Taliban pushing women in full burka. An observant child (and what child isn't) will have a lot of questions about the illustrations throughout the book, so be prepared and look forward to some great conversations about different cultures, about war and violence, about reality. The gold returns on the last page when she is giving her UN speech. Very well done.
